  • Hello @cortig! 👋

    I'm sorry to hear that 1Password isn't working properly Touch ID. It sounds like communication between the 1Password extension in your browser and the 1Password for Mac app has broken down. Please try the following:

    1. Close all open web browsers.
    2. Right-click on the 1Password icon at the top of your Mac's screen and then click Quit. Wait until the icon disappears.
    3. Double-click on 1Password from your Mac's Application folder.
    4. Open your web browser.

    Let me know if that fixes the issue.
